Excessive urination, which is defined by at least 2.5 liters of urine per day for an adult, can be caused by several different things. The most common would be drinking large amounts of fluids, especially caffeine or alcohol. Also, a frequent symptom of diabetes is excessive urination. If you already have diabetes, it could be caused by too much salt or glucose intake. Other causes include taking diuretics and certain medications, kidney failure, sickle cell anemia, psychogenic polydipsia, and having an image test done with contrast media injected.

Yes, consuming too much salt can cause ankle/foot swelling. Because over consumption will cause the body to retain more water, the ankles can swell from the water retention.
